Body

Origins and Family

Vincenz Czerny's place of birth was Trutnov[2]. Recorded date of birth include November 19, 1842[3] and January 1, 1842[10]. His father was Q138051679[12].

Education

Educated at University of Vienna[23], a university[28], in Austria[29], founded in 1365[30], headquartered in Vienna[31] and Charles University[24], a public university[32], in Czech Republic[33], founded in 1348[34], headquartered in Prague[35]. Vincenz Czerny earned the academic degree of doctorate[36].

Career and Affiliations

Recorded occupations include physician[6], professor[7], and surgeon[8]. Employers include University of Freiburg[21], a public university[37], in Germany[38], founded in 1457[39], headquartered in Freiburg im Breisgau[40] and Heidelberg University[22], a public research university[41], in Germany[42], founded in 1386[43], headquartered in Heidelberg[44]. Vincenz Czerny held the position of Geheimrat[20].

Personal Life

Among Vincenz Czerny's spouses was Q138051668[13]. Children include Q138051799[14]; Q138051828[15]; Siegfried Czerny[16], a painter[45], 1889–1979[46], of Germany[47]; and Q138051956[17].

Death and Burial

Vincenz Czerny died on October 3, 1916[5]. He passed away in Heidelberg[4]. Burial took place at Bergfriedhof[11].
